
Israruddin Israr
Israruddin Israr is the Human Rights Commission of Pakistan coordinator for Gilgit-Baltistan (GB). He has been vocal about the challenges faced by flood survivors in the region, particularly following recent glacial lake outburst floods that displaced thousands. He has highlighted the need for better emergency response systems and assistance for internally displaced persons.
